Fair Isaac Shares: A Market Divided by Extreme Views

Fair Isaac Corporation finds itself at the center of a dramatic market divergence. While technical indicators flash signals of strength, a substantial chasm separates the assessments of financial analysts. Price targets ranging from $1,038 to $2,170 define the current polarized sentiment surrounding the stock.

Institutional and Insider Selling Adds Pressure

Recent activity from major investors provides crucial context for the stock’s volatility. Data reveals that Silphium Asset Management scaled back its stake in Fair Isaac by 25.0%. The firm disposed of 383 shares, leaving it with a holding of 1,152 shares valued at approximately $2.1 million.

This institutional pullback aligns with a pattern of insider disposals. At the beginning of November, CEO William J. Lansing sold 2,400 shares for roughly $4.16 million. In total, over the past 90 days, company insiders have liquidated 20,432 shares with a collective value of about $32.25 million. Such concentrated selling activity is frequently interpreted by the market as a cautionary signal for near-term price appreciation.

A Stark Divide in Analyst Conviction

The contrasting opinions from Wall Street researchers could scarcely be more pronounced. On November 26, Autonomous Research demonstrated a bearish stance by reducing its price target to $1,038 and reaffirming its “Underperform” recommendation. This rating suggests the firm anticipates significant downward movement from the current trading level.

In a sharp rebuttal to this pessimistic outlook, RBC Capital maintained a decidedly bullish position on the very same day. Analyst Ashish Sabadra confirmed a “Buy” rating, supporting it with a lofty price objective of $2,170. The gap of over $1,100 between these two prominent assessments underscores the profound uncertainty in determining the stock’s fair value.

Technical Resilience Meets Lofty Valuation

Despite the skepticism from certain analysts and the wave of selling, the stock exhibits notable technical vigor. Its Relative Strength Rating, a metric that gauges price performance against the broader market, advanced on Wednesday from 63 to 74. This improvement indicates building momentum relative to the overall market over the preceding 52-week period.

From a fundamental perspective, the company’s elevated valuation remains the core point of contention. With a market capitalization of $42.6 billion and a price-to-earnings ratio exceeding 67, Fair Isaac’s stock appears to be pricing in flawless execution. The firm recently posted quarterly revenue of $515.8 million and adjusted earnings per share of $7.74. While these figures confirm ongoing growth, the “Underperform” rating from Autonomous Research implies that the current valuation multiples may be unsustainable.

The question for investors is whether the shares can bridge this extreme valuation gap. The tension between the confirmed 2026 EPS forecast of $38.17 and the present high multiples is a primary driver of volatility. Market participants are currently balancing the stock’s improved technical momentum against the tangible selling pressure from corporate insiders and institutional funds.
